Effect Info: | Glutamine (Gln) effectively protects mice from lethal endotoxic shock by rapidly inducing mitogen-activated protein kinase phosphatase-1 (MKP-1). Studies have shown that Gln can inhibit the activities of p38 and JNK within 10 minutes and induce the phosphorylation of MKP-1 protein within approximately 5 minutes. |

Sentence: | "The ERK inhibitor U0126 blocked Gln-induced MKP-1 phosphorylation and protein induction, as well as Gln's protective activity against endotoxic shock." |
